Anderson Soares de Oliveira or simply Anderson Bamba (born 10 January 1988) is a Brazilian football central defender who last played for Eintracht Frankfurt.

Flamengo

Anderson Oliveira started his career with Flamengo. He excelled in winning the third championship of the junior state championship and the Junior Cup OPG.

Anderson began his career professional in 2006, with Flamengo and was sold to Tombense in January 2008.
Germany

In the summer 2008, German club Bayer Leverkusen secured the transfer rights to Anderson. He played the 2008–09 season for Osnabrück, "on loan" from Bayer Leverkusen despite the fact that he didn't have a contract with the Bundesliga club. On 1 July 2009, he agreed to be loaned to Fortuna Düsseldorf for the 2009–10 season. On 1 April 2010, he signed with Borussia Mönchengladbach and joined his new team on 1 July. After one season in Gladbach, Anderson was loaned to the newly relegated Eintracht Frankfurt.
